Position Summary:
Join our FAA-certified repair station specializing in the overhaul and repair of aviation safety equipment, including fire extinguishers, oxygen bottles, and related components. We’re looking for a hands-on, detail-oriented individual who is eager to learn and grow in a regulated industry. No prior aviation experience? No problem—we provide full training for candidates with the right attitude and work ethic.
What You’ll Do:
- Inspect, repair, and overhaul safety components such as fire suppression systems, fire extinguishers, oxygen masks, and cylinder/regulator assemblies.
- Operate test equipment (pressure gauges) to ensure compliance with safety standards.
- Perform welding and assembly tasks following detailed instructions and specifications.
- Complete accurate documentation and maintain compliance with FAA regulations.
- Troubleshoot mechanical issues using manuals and provided training.
- Maintain a clean, safe work environment and report any safety concerns.
- Other duties as assigned.
What We’re Looking For:
- Education: High School Diploma or GED required.
- Willingness to learn – We’ll train you on specialized processes and equipment.
- Hands-on mindset – Comfortable working with tools and getting involved in technical tasks.
- Attention to detail – Accuracy matters in a regulated industry.
- Dependability – Ability to follow procedures, meet deadlines, work overtime and weekends as required by business needs.
- Team player – Works well with others in a collaborative environment.
Preferred Skills (Not Required):
- Experience with hand tools or mechanical work.
- Familiarity with welding or assembly tasks.
- Ability to read and follow technical instructions.
- Previous experience in regulated industries (manufacturing, automotive, aviation, aerospace, pharmaceutical) is a plus.

Does AMETEK sponsor H-1B visas for Technicians?
Yes, AMETEK has sponsored H-1B visas for Technician roles. The H-1B requires the position to qualify as a specialty occupation, meaning it must typically require at least a bachelor's degree in a relevant technical field. For Technician roles, this determination depends on the specific responsibilities and the division hiring, so confirming this early in the process with the recruiter is important.

Which visa types does AMETEK commonly use for Technician hires?
AMETEK supports several visa types for Technician positions, including H-1B, F-1 OPT, F-1 CPT, TN, and J-1. F-1 OPT and CPT are common entry points for recent graduates getting hands-on experience. The TN visa is an option for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ying technical occupations. H-1B sponsorship is available for longer-term employment where the role meets specialty occupation criteria.

How do I understand the sponsorship timeline for a Technician role at AMETEK?
For H-1B sponsorship, USCIS standard processing takes several months, with premium processing available to reduce this to roughly 15 business days. For F-1 OPT, work authorization must be in place before your start date. TN status for Canadian citizens can often be obtained at the border on the day of travel. Clarifying the expected start date with AMETEK's recruiter early helps you map the right visa pathway against your personal timeline.
